Moldova Innovation Technology Park (MITP) has recently concluded the SUM IT UP 4 Impact event, which highlighted the significant growth and transformation of the IT industry in Moldova. Over the past five years, MITP has become the largest entrepreneurial IT community in the country, hosting over 1,400 companies and generating 11% of the country's total exports. As a result, the IT sector has become increasingly attractive to both local and international professionals and investors.

During the event, a series of presentations unveiled impressive statistics that showcased the exponential growth and impact of MITP on the IT industry. The number of MITP residents has increased fourfold from 2018 to 2022, surging from 338 to 1,308. Foreign investment in the sector has also doubled during this period, with the number of companies with foreign capital rising from 97 to 207.

In terms of economic contribution, 73% of Moldova's IT industry revenue is generated by MITP residents. Furthermore, the IT industry's contribution to the country’s GDP has increased from 2.7% to 5.1%, with 82% of all IT employees working within MITP resident companies.

The proposed IT Park Law reform, still in draft form, seeks to extend the term of activity from 10 to 20 years, with a guarantee from the state for the entire duration of the park's activity, following the regional trends in neighboring countries of Romania, Ukraine, and Belarus. The Moldovan IT sector grew its export volume five times since 2016, outpacing growth in Estonia, Belarus, Romania, and Ukraine. Without this extension, it is estimated that over €683 million in potential taxes to the state could be lost. During the event, the Minister of Economic Development and Digitalization, Dumitru Alaiba, has confirmed the support that the Moldovan government will continue to show towards the efforts of MITP in strengthening the country’s tech ecosystem. 

The event also highlighted several success stories from MITP residents, emphasizing the critical role of the park in supporting the growth of startups and established IT companies alike. As a central hub for innovation, MITP has fostered an environment that encourages collaboration, knowledge sharing, and the development of cutting-edge technologies.

Viorica Vanica, one of the speakers and co-founder of SelfTalk, has stated that thanks to the fast-paced development of the Moldovan tech industry and support from MITP that the team decided to move back after years of living abroad.

“It’s not all about the unique 7% tax for us investors, it’s also about the opportunities to participate in international events, and valuable networking with like-minded people from the ecosystem.”
